Veda Rogers grew up in Quenemo, Kansas, married her childhood sweetheart, and they went on to establish Vassar Playhouse near their hometown. Located at Pomona Lake 35 miles south of Topeka, they ran the theatre sixteen seasons beginning in 1970. Veda has more in common with Ginger Rogers than their roles of Dolly Levi; Vedas father-in-law, John Rogers, was Gingers stepfather, Daddy John. He helped to get Ginger started in her career, managing her Vaudeville tour for two years, 19261927. This book is Vedas storythe story of Vassar Playhouseher family, the players, their griefs and their joys. Butbecause of her husband, Bruce, Ginger also plays a part. BABY SING & SIGN is a wonderful, sensory-rich way to teach and practice key sign language vocabulary with hearing babies and toddlers. Sign language is a proven way to jump start language and provide little ones with important communication skills to express their wants and needs before they are able to speak. We use the child's preferred activities -- music and play -- to engage families in language learning. The program is great "baby brain food" and fun and easy for the entire family. The Parent Guide gives families all the tools they need to be successful teaching baby sign and supporting their child's emerging language.
Finally, a way to ease the most challenging times of day with baby. Since signed gestures enable babies to "tell" caregivers what they want and need before they can talk, mealtime and bedtime are occasions when signing can really come in handy. Based on Dr. Miller's popular workshops, Mealtime and Bedtime Sing & Sign is a user-friendly guide featuring over 200 signs with photos, instructions, and activities. An all-new, 12-song CD with upbeat music followed by calm lullabies teaches and reinforces key signs.

James Mark Brown was born August 18, 1955 in Toledo, Ohio. His parents are Jonathan Lee Brown and Betty Ann Shaffer. Cheryl Anne Gustafson was born August 7, 1957 in Meadville, Pennsylvania. Her parents are Everett William Gustafson and Esther Constance Belding. James and Cheryl were married in 1976 in Brockway, Pennsylvania. Traces their ancestors and living relatives in Virginia, Ohio, Pennsylvania, North Carolina, Kentucky, Massachusetts and elsewhere.
